Programme structure
Year 0
Introduction to Law
Academic Skills
Introduction to Legal Theory
Introduction to UK Human Rights
Year 1
Foundations of the Law of Obligations
Contract Law
Academic, Legal and Professional Skills
Foundations of Property Law
Public Law I
Criminal Law
Year 2
Tort Law
Land Law
Public Law II
Law of the European Union
Equity and Trusts
Animal Protection and Wildlife Law (optional)
Introduction to comparative law (optional)
Career Management Skills
Final year
Equity and Trusts (optional)
Jurisprudence I (optional)
Introduction to Public International Law (optional)
Selected Issues in Public International Law (optional)
Public Law II (optional)
Medicine & the Law I (optional)
Clinical Legal Education (Law Placement) (optional)
Consumer Contract Law (optional)
Career opportunities
Our graduates pursue careers in the law and in a wide range of other sectors including business and commerce, accountancy, insurance, banking, central and local government, academia, teaching, social work and the police force.
